63: Turnabout is Fair Play: Our Favorite Perspective Reversals

from The Thinking Practitioner · host Til Luchau & Whitney Lowe

People change their minds--sometimes, radically. Learning, improving, refining, all involve changing how we saw things before. But is there a cost? And what makes changing our views such a challenge? Whitney and Til compare notes about how their perspectives have taken a 180° from how they used to think, and, about how that's played out.
